  • Obligation to teach one's children to swim
  • “The Talmud also specifies that parents should teach their children how to swim. In the ancient world, where much travel occurred over water, swimming was a necessary survival skill. In modern parlance, this commandment means that parents are required to teach their children whatever self-defense skills are necessary for survival. In her book How to Run a Traditional Jewish Household, writer Blu Greenberg recalls an ugly incident in her neighborhood in which a number of antisemitic teenagers attacked and beat a group of Jewish teenagers. The local rabbi's response was a sensible one, and entirely consistent with the Talmud's ruling. "The time has come," he in effect told the parents, "to teach Jewish kids karate."”
    • -- Jewish Literacy, Rabbi Joseph Telushkin, pg 538, 1st ed.
